The Washington Boro Society for Susquehanna River Heritage also known as bluerockheritage is restoring the Witmer Grist Mill to display Susquehannock Indian Artifacts, duck hunting, shad fishing, Pennsylvania RailRoad, Havana Wrapper Tobacco,  Intrader traders, Longhouse, Susquehanna River Islands and many other items relatin to Woodstock, Charlestown, Shultztown and Washington Boro, Pa.

Our mission is to promote and conserve the rich history of the Lower Susquehanna River Valley through education, preservation and restoration; and to increase public awareness of its archeological and historical resources, features and buildings, and their unique inter-relationship with and access to the local ecological systems.
